I recall seeing that little memorial down there at Tidal river with the double diamond on it .
I have another article in MS word doc. format - detailing the wartime history of the Port Welshpool long jetty . Quite large vessels could moor right alongside it . There was a flotilla of 3-4 ships , commandeered civilian ships, ancient things , coal burners ,fitted out as mine sweepers . The HMAS Orara was so leaky , they had plated its hull with myriad patches. The navy sailed it down to the prom. and that was the limit. A ship, SS CAmbridge ,was mined and sank just off the prom. A German raider PASSAT ,laid the mines in Bass Strait.
